Ecuador Reports H5N1 HPAI

11/30/2022

According to a ProMED posting on November 28th, authorities in Ecuador reported an outbreak of H5N1 strain HPAI on November 25th.  The case involved a 180,000-hen laying operation in Chaguana a large regional center south of Quito.  According to the report, the flock showed a rapid rise in mortality, attaining 28 percent.  The diagnosis was confirmed by a state-operated, (Agrocalidad) laboratory applying PCR.  According to Dr. Patricio Almeda, Executive Director of Agrocalidad, appropriate control measures were implemented including depopulation of the farm and surveillance and quarantine. 

 

This is the first report of H5N1 Avian Influenza in Ecuador.  Columbia has reported 19 outbreaks, mostly in backyard flocks and in wild birds.  On November 18th, Peru reported an outbreak in pelicans.
